ZERO DROPOUTS : TRANSFORMING LIVES, STARTING YOUNG

ZERO DROPOUTS TRANSFORMING LIVES, STARTING YOUNG Tara foundation had investigated that Almost 90% of dropouts are from the B40 families.When a Tamil school student fails Bahasa Malaysia or English, they end up in Remove Classes when they enter secondary school.
